Output e2a0d6c8b344d2a1c32cefff966a3d75b96f61b76a7201987c76ee90818e35bb:1

value
137956959
script pubkey
OP_0 OP_PUSHBYTES_20 84821356f81601a7152cec276f450976d2372e27
address
bc1qsjppx4hczcq6w9fvasnk73gfwmfrwt38qjg8mg
transaction
e2a0d6c8b344d2a1c32cefff966a3d75b96f61b76a7201987c76ee90818e35bb
confirmations
173934
spent
true